The building will showcase the latest innovations in high performance construction technology, energy efficient design and use of renewable energy resources. It is designed to meet the highest "Platinum" rating of the U.S. Green Building Council's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design The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design (LEED) Green Building Rating System, developed by the U.S. Green Building Council, provides a suite of standards for environmentally sustainable construction. system. The ARD Ard (ärd), in the Bible. 1 Son of Benjamin. 2 Benjamite, perhaps the same as (1.) An alternate form is Addar. building will be one of only five Platinum LEED facilities in the world. Construction is scheduled to begin in summer 2005. About $500,000 of the APS $1 million donation will be directed toward construction of the new building. The ARD facility will house several NAU environmental and community partnership programs. The facility will also serve as a hub for campus sustainability efforts and provide opportunities for student environmental projects. The LEED certification application will include the construction and installation of a 160-kilowatt photovoltaic system that will provide at least 20 percent of the electricity for the ARD building. An additional $500,000 will come from APS' Environmental Portfolio Standard Credit Purchase Program, made possible by the Arizona Corporation Commission's adoption of the program in 2001.
